The Cosmetic Skin Clinic acquired by Harley Street treatment specialist
The Cosmetic Skin Clinic (CSC) has been acquired by The Private Clinic Group as part of its continuing expansion.
CSC specialises in offering non-surgical cosmetic solutions from its clinics in London and Buckinghamshire, with treatments including CoolSculpting and Ultherapy.
Announced by private equity firm and parent company BlueGem, the deal follows a number of acquisitions of other cosmetic treatment firms such as Hans Place, Regency Medical and Aurora Clinics.
Emilio Di Spiezio Sardo, BlueGem co-founder and partner, and Sarah Walker, BlueGem director, commented: “We are delighted to announce the acquisition of The Cosmetic Skin Clinic by The Private Clinic Group.
“Today’s acquisition further supports our vision to be the leading consolidator of premium cosmetics clinics in the UK.”
